Description
Gabrielle is a Computer Engineering and Computer Science student at Northeastern University, where she is pursuing her Bachelor of Science degree. She offers tutoring in a range of subjects, drawing on her strong academic background and diverse experiences.
Gabrielle has served as a teaching assistant for engineering courses in college, providing direct instructional support to students. Her commitment to fostering a love of learning stems from her own positive experiences with great educators, and she excels at connecting with students and building their passion for academic exploration. This approach is evident in her prior experience giving art and English lessons while babysitting, demonstrating an early aptitude for nurturing young minds.
Academically, Gabrielle has engaged deeply in relevant coursework such as Software Engineering, Computer Architecture, and Database Design. Her capstone project, “Chiplet: A Smart Circuit Lab,” involved designing a modular system to teach computer architecture, showcasing her ability to break down complex topics into understandable components. Beyond her academic pursuits, Gabrielle has held several co-op positions at companies like Keurig Dr. Pepper, Tulip Interfaces, and Seres Therapeutics, where she honed her technical documentation, UX research, and engineering skills. She is a dedicated communicator who believes in every student’s capacity to learn, aiming to equip your child with the tools for long-term academic success.
